Sleep

How to Construct Attribute Rich Types in Vue.js #.\n\nKinds play a major part in making complicated as well as involved internet requests from messaging a co-worker, to scheduling a flight, to composing a blog post. None of these make use of situations, plus an entire host of others, will be possible without types.\nWhen working in Vue.js my visit answer for constructing kinds is contacted FormKit. The API it offers creating inputs and forms is efficient for easy effective usage however is actually pliable sufficient to become personalized for practically any use instance. In this particular article, permit's have a look at a few of the features that produce it such an enjoyment to utilize.\nSteady API Throughout Input Types.\nIndigenous web browser inputs are actually a wreck of various HTML tags: inputs, picks, textarea, etc. FormKit supplies a single part for all input styles.\n\n\n\n\n\nThis handy user interface makes it effortless to:.\nI especially like the choose, which takes it is actually alternatives in a very JavaScript-y manner in which makes it quick and easy to collaborate with in Vue.\nComponent Abundant Recognition.\nVerification with FormKit is actually super effortless. The only thing that is actually called for is incorporating a recognition uphold to the FormKit element.\n\nThere are actually plenty of verification guidelines that deliver with FormKit, consisting of generally used ones like called for, url, email, and also even more. Guidelines could be likewise be chained to use much more than one policy to a single input and can also allow debates to individualize exactly how they behave. Not to mention the Laravel-like phrase structure experiences wonderful and familiar for folks like myself.\n\nThe exact as well as comfortably positioned error messages create a terrific individual knowledge as well as demands actually 0 effort for the designer.\n\nThey can easily also be actually conveniently set up to display\/hide depending on to your timing inclination.\nPlay with the instance in the screenshot above here or watch a FREE Vue Institution online video tutorial on FormKit verification for additional information.\nKinds and Article Condition.\nWhen you provide a kind along with JavaScript, typically you need to have to make an async request. While this demand is actually waiting for a feedback, it is actually excellent user knowledge to reveal a filling indicator as well as guarantee the form isn't repetitively sent. FormKit cares for this by nonpayment when you wrap your FormKit inputs along with a FormKit form. When your provide trainer yields a pledge it will express your form in a packing state, disable the submit switch, turn off all document industries, and present a content spinner. The FormKit type even generates the submit switch for you (isn't that therefore good!). You can enjoy with the example in the screenshot listed below listed below.\n\nInternationalization (i18n).\nHave a global audience? No problem! They can easily all engage along with your forms since FormKit includes help for 18n away from the box.\nbring in createApp from 'vue'.\nimport Application coming from 'App.vue'.\nimport plugin, defaultConfig from '@formkit\/ vue'.\nimport de, fr, zh coming from '@formkit\/ i18n'.\n\nconst app = createApp( Application).\napp.use(.\nplugin,.\ndefaultConfig( \n\/\/ Specify added places.\nlocations: de, fr, zh,.\n\/\/ Specify the active area.\nlocale: 'fr',.\n ).\n).\napp.mount('

app').Completely Extensible.FormKit's integrated offerings are actually more than enough 90% of the moment but you additionally possess numerous alternatives for expanding it and also creating it your personal. There are actually several ways you can easily make FormKit go also additionally.Check out there certainly variety of pro inputs that includes a rich collection of non-native inputs.Create your personal custom FormKit inputs (our experts present you how in our training course Strong Vue.js Forms along with FormKit).Use plugins to create project-wide personalizations that are administered around all inputs. FormKit possesses a couple of great main plugins as well as this fantastic page of examples that you can copy/paste for your personal use.Certain regarding how traits look? It is actually possesses a comprehensive theming system, makes ports nicely available, and lessons effortlessly customizable.Conclusion.Types can feel like a trivial feature-add but any kind of professional programmer understands the intricacy can accumulate quickly. FormKit packages a lot of this particular complication up in a good pleasing package deal as well as gives it to you with a simple however feature abundant API.Offer FormKit a try out. It's FREE as well as open resource and also I guarantee you won't regret it. Plus, if you're looking to acquire one of the most out of it, we dive deeper into FormKit in our video course: Robust Vue.js Types with FormKit.

Articles You Can Be Interested In